>This is a bump of KYLIN-976 in case you are not yet aware...
>
>KYLIN-976 is a refactoring of how Kylin works with aggregation and aims to
>allow adding custom aggregation types easily.
>
>Kylin started with basic support of SUM, COUNT, MAX, MIN, AVG (from sum
>and
>count), and COUNT_DISTINCT (based on hyperloglog). Later TopN is added in
>2.x branch. And the list is growing for sure. Xiaoyu is working on storing
>raw records as a special type of measure (KYLIN-1122), also Yerui is
>working on precise count distinct using bitmap (KYLIN-1186).
>
>The possibility is unlimited. Implement a domain specific aggregation is
>now quite easy. E.g. aggregate user events to detect time serials or
>access
>patterns. Or draw a sketch of certain user groups. Or pre-calculate
>clusters of data points. Or histogram... Use your imagination.
>
>Whoever interested can peek at MeasureTypeFactory and MeasureType on 2.x
>branch. The API may still change, but at the same time is stable enough
>for
>pilots. The javadoc should get you started. HLLCMeasureType and
>TopNMeasureType are two good examples.
